Designing a Gourmet Kitchen with a Chef's Touch

If you're a serious cook, then you'll want to design your gourmet kitchen with a chef's touch. That means incorporating professional-grade appliances like a gas range, plenty of counter space for food prep, and ample storage for all your cooking tools. You may also want to consider adding a commercial-grade sink for easy cleaning and installing a pot filler for convenience.

Key Features of a Gourmet Kitchen

designing a gourmet kitchen One of the main features of a gourmet kitchen is high-quality appliances. A professional-grade stove, oven, and refrigerator are essential for creating gourmet dishes. These appliances are not only functional but also add to the overall aesthetic of the kitchen. Stainless steel appliances are a popular choice for gourmet kitchens, as they give off a sleek and modern look. Another important aspect of a gourmet kitchen is ample counter space. This allows for multiple people to work in the kitchen at the same time, making it perfect for hosting parties or cooking with family and friends. Granite or marble countertops are often chosen for their durability and elegance.

Designing a Gourmet Kitchen

designing a gourmet kitchen When designing a gourmet kitchen, it is important to consider both style and functionality. Open shelving and glass-front cabinets are popular design elements in gourmet kitchens, as they allow for easy access to cooking essentials and add to the overall aesthetic of the space. Lighting is also crucial in a gourmet kitchen, as it not only helps with cooking but also sets the mood for entertaining. Pendant lights above the kitchen island or under-cabinet lighting are common choices for this type of kitchen. In terms of layout, a gourmet kitchen typically follows the classic work triangle, with the stove, sink, and refrigerator placed in close proximity for efficiency. However, incorporating a secondary sink or prep area can be a game-changer for those who love to cook and entertain.
